CSS是一種可以用來使網(wǎng)頁具有美觀外觀和布局的樣式表語言,同時也是一種用來修改、控制和排版HTML網(wǎng)頁元素的標準語言。CSS從1、2、3三個版本不斷地發(fā)展演變,從最初的簡單的樣式表語言到逐漸完善的布局屬性,再到3版本的強大的選擇器和動畫效果,讓CSS在網(wǎng)頁設(shè)計中發(fā)揮了更大的作用。
以下是CSS1中的樣式表 h1 { font-size: 24px; color: red; } p { font-size: 16px; color: blue; } CSS1版本只允許基本的字體、顏色和文本對齊屬性,同時對布局、浮動和選擇器的支持比較有限。 以下是CSS2中的樣式表 h1 { font-size: 24px; color: red; margin-top: 20px; margin-bottom: 20px; text-align: center; } p { font-size: 16px; color: blue; margin-left: 50px; margin-right: 50px; line-height: 1.5; text-align: justify; } CSS2版本增加了許多布局和選擇器屬性,比如文本對齊、邊距、字間距等,同時增加了瀏覽器樣式表的支持,讓開發(fā)人員可以更加方便地定義網(wǎng)頁樣式和布局。 以下是CSS3中的樣式表 h1 { font-size: 24px; color: red; margin: 20px auto; text-align: center; text-shadow: 2px 2px 2px grey; } p { font-size: 16px; color: blue; margin: 0 20px 20px 20px; line-height: 1.5; text-align: justify; transition: all 1s ease; } CSS3版本增加了更多的選擇器和布局屬性,同時還支持了動畫效果和響應(yīng)式設(shè)計,可以讓頁面更加生動和交互性更高。
總之,CSS1、CSS2、CSS3都是一個不斷發(fā)展壯大的語言,為我們的網(wǎng)頁制作提供了更好的視覺和交互效果,從而提升了用戶的體驗感受。在web開發(fā)中,CSS是一個非常重要的技術(shù),通過熟練掌握和使用它們,可以讓我們的網(wǎng)站呈現(xiàn)出更加優(yōu)美和專業(yè)的外觀。